Bio Trade Market Size (2025-2030)
The Bio Trade Market was valued at USD 5.5 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ach a market size of USD 19.78 billion by the end of 2030. Over the forecast period of 2025-2030, the market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 23.78%.
The Bio Trade Market encompasses the sustainable sourcing, production, and commercialization of biological resources, including herbal products, organic foods, essential oils, and natural cosmetics, with a focus on preserving biodiversity and promoting ethical trade practices. Driven by growing consumer preference for natural, organic, and eco-friendly products, Bio Trade integrates environmental, social, and economic sustainability throughout the supply chain, from cultivation to retail. The market is expanding across healthcare, nutraceuticals, food and beverages, and personal care sectors, supported by increasing awareness of health, wellness, and environmentally responsible consumption. Furthermore, rising global demand for traceable, high-quality natural ingredients and international initiatives promoting fair trade and sustainable sourcing are providing significant growth opportunities, positioning Bio Trade as a critical driver of both economic development and ecological stewardship.
Key Market Insights:
The BioTrade market is experiencing robust growth as consumer demand for herbal and organic products continues to rise, with studies indicating that over 65% of global consumers now prefer natural or plant-based ingredients in personal care and food products.
Essential oils and plant extracts are witnessing strong adoption, with over 70% of aromatherapy and natural wellness products incorporating these ingredients, highlighting their growing role in healthcare and personal care applications.
In the nutraceutical sector, BioTrade ingredients are being increasingly used, with supplements and functional foods showing a 35% year-on-year growth in the incorporation of natural bioactive compounds.
The sustainable and ethical sourcing aspect of BioTrade is also gaining importance, with more than 50% of manufacturers now prioritizing traceable, fair-trade certified ingredients to meet consumer expectations and regulatory requirements.
Organic foods and beverages are gaining traction—sales of organic products in the Netherlands have surged by over 51% in the past five years, underscoring the growing health and sustainability demands conveyed by consumers.

Market Restraints and Challenges:
The BioTrade market faces several significant restraints and challenges that could impact its growth trajectory, primarily stemming from the high cost and complexity of sustainable sourcing, certification, and production processes. Many small and medium-sized enterprises struggle to comply with stringent regulatory standards, fair-trade certifications, and traceability requirements, which can limit market entry and scalability. Additionally, supply chain disruptions caused by climate change, seasonal variability of biological resources, and geopolitical factors can affect the consistent availability of high-quality raw materials. The market also contends with limited awareness and understanding among certain consumer segments, which may hinder demand for sustainably sourced products, particularly in regions where natural or organic alternatives are still emerging. Moreover, competition from synthetic substitutes and non-certified products that are cheaper and easier to produce poses a further challenge, while the technical expertise required for processing, formulation, and standardization of bio-based products adds complexity for manufacturers looking to maintain quality and efficacy.

Recent Trends and Developments in the Global Automotive Lighting Market:
A development collaboration between OSRAM Continental and REHAU aims to incorporate lighting into external components, providing automobile manufacturers with innovative lighting options that improve functionality and design flexibility. For rear combination lamps, Hella unveiled a revolutionary lighting innovation called Hella FlatLight technology. A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) was signed by Samvardhana Motherson Automotive Systems Group BV (SMRPBV), a division of Motherson Group, and Marelli Automotive Lighting to investigate a technology collaboration focused on intelligently lighted external body components. Valeo debuted their revolutionary 360° lighting system at the Shanghai Auto Show. This technology surrounds the car with a band of light, projecting instantaneous, clear signs that other drivers can see from a distance. Pedestrians, cyclists, and scooter riders are especially susceptible to these signals
